Que.
Pentazocine is a benomorphan derivate .It has alkyl group at C-3 position .Identify it .
A.
-CH=CH(CH3)2
B.
-CH2 CH=C(CH3)2
C.
= CH-CH2 CH (CH3)2
D.
-CH (CH3)2
Right Answer is :
✓ B. -CH2 CH=C(CH3)2
